Google reveals Stadia, its game streaming service

At GDC in the present day, Google revealed Stadia, its game streaming service – which it plans to make use of to “build a game platform for everyone”. The firm confirmed how the expertise will work which if profitable, might have monumental affect.

The gadget will stream games at 60fps and 4k, so that you’ll wish to ensure that your web bandwidth is as much as scratch, and there’s even a bespoke controller for it. It’s based mostly on a customized GPU that may kick out “more than ten teraflops of power”. According to Google, anybody can stream the newest games inside seconds, throughout all gadgets.

It confirmed Stadia working with Assassin’s Creed Odyssey, which was tried on telephone, pill, TV, and “the least powerful PC we could find”. While clearly in optimum situations, the game loaded inside moments and ran completely throughout all of those techniques.

Google additionally confirmed how Assassin’s Creed Odyssey labored from inside YouTube. Attached to a YouTube trailer was a ‘Play Now’ possibility, and gamers can merely click on on this button to immediately be transported into the game – inside 5 seconds, in accordance with Google. No obtain, no patch, no difficult set up process.

The game is streamed fully by way of Google Chrome utilizing the brand new Stadia service. A spread of games are deliberate for the service, and Google additionally has its personal controller constructed for Stadia.
